About 126 Pike St
Weirton Heights – Looking for acreage in the city? This level half-acre lot could be yours, along with a charming 3-bedroom brick Cape Cod that offers numerous recent updates! Improvements include blown-in insulation, fresh paint throughout, a newly added full bath on the main floor, new flooring throughout, a new roof (2024), updated furnace and AC (2015), new dormer siding (2024), replacement windows (2015), and updated plumbing (all per seller, approximate dates). The upper level offers two generously sized bedrooms with abundant closet space, a full bath, and a convenient built-in cabinet with drawers in the hallway. Step outside to enjoy the expansive, level half-acre lot — ideal for a future pool, gazebo, garden, or simply enjoying the spacious yard. Relax on the covered front porch in the evenings. Conveniently located near Route 22 for easy access to Pittsburgh, and close to the hospital, schools, shopping, post office, churches, and all the amenities this centrally located neighborhood has to offer.

Living in Weirton, WV
Transportation in Weirton features a combination of private and public transit options, catering to the needs of commuters and local travelers alike. The community's road network connects seamlessly to major highways, facilitating easy travel to neighboring cities and states. While the area's walkability varies, there are neighborhoods known for their pedestrian-friendly environments. Public transportation services are available, providing residents with alternatives to private vehicle use, and the city is also served by ride-sharing options, enhancing mobility within the community.
Residents of Weirton benefit from a solid network of essential services, including public schools that serve different age groups, healthcare facilities equipped to provide a range of medical services, and a public library system that supports lifelong learning. The retail and dining landscape mirrors the local culture, with a selection of shops and eateries that cater to various tastes and preferences. The city is attentive to the evolving needs of its residents, with initiatives aimed at enhancing service provision in line with demographic trends.
Weirton prides itself on a strong sense of community and a rich industrial heritage that continues to shape its identity. The city is celebrated for its annual festivals and community events that foster a spirit of togetherness and showcase local talents and businesses. The area's character is further defined by its scenic views of the Ohio River and the surrounding Appalachian foothills, offering residents a blend of urban amenities and natural beauty.
The housing landscape in Weirton is characterized by a mix of single-family homes and smaller multi-unit buildings, reflecting a community that values both privacy and neighborly connection. Architectural styles vary, with a noticeable presence of mid-century and ranch-style homes. The market is primarily composed of owner-occupied residences, with a homeownership rate that underscores the community's commitment to long-term investment and stability.
